International Helmet Awareness Day 2012
 
Charles Owen will once again partner with Riders4Helmets in supporting International Helmet Awareness Day in the summer of 2012. The goal of this day is to unite retailers across the globe to promote helmet and safety awareness.
 
Riders4Helmets is a non-profit helmet awareness group founded as a result of International Dressage rider Courtney King-Dye's traumatic brain injury incurred while riding without a helmet.  The mission of this group is to educate equestrians on the basic facts of wearing a helmet and to promote the helmet wearing campaign on an international level by involving leading equestrians in various disciplines that hopefully encourage an increased use of helmets. Riders4Helmets also provide important links/resources to enable riders to become further educated on the importance of wearing a helmet.
